Technical Specifications: The Peugeot e-5008 73 kWh Dual Motor
For those who want to dig deeper, an appendix below offers all the manufacturer-quoted figures for the Peugeot e-5008 73 kWh Dual Motor. These numbers highlight the engineering that makes this already extraordinary family car SUV so impressive when it comes to its on-road and day-to-day usability. With this in-depth breakdown of the Peugeot e-5008 73 kWh Dual Motor specs, you can easily understand what you will be dealing with.This information includes the vehicle’s physical size, powertrain output, charging and capacity and more. These details are essential to understanding the e-5008, which we have derived its space, power and efficiency. Please bear in mind these figures are supplied by Peugeot and may vary slightly based on market, tyre and wheel fitment and optional equipment.This specification sheet provides a quick guide to the e-5008 Dual Motor’s technology. It measures a vehicle’s capacity to tote a big family, provide solid all-wheel-drive traction, and fit readily into the electric vehicle lifestyle with useful charging options. The figures confirm what the driving experience indicates: this is a well-considered, highly functional electric SUV.
| Specification | Value (Manufacturer-Quoted) |
|---|---|
| Powertrain | Dual Motor All-Wheel Drive (AWD) |
| Battery Capacity | 73 kWh (usable) |
| Total Motor Power | 240 kW / 320 bhp |
| Front Motor Power | 157 kW |
| Rear Motor Power | 83 kW |
| Total Torque | 345 Nm (Front) + 170 Nm (Rear) |
| Electric Range (WLTP) | Up to 500 km (approx. 310 miles) |
| 0-100 km/h (0-62 mph) | 6.9 seconds |
| Top Speed | 180 km/h (112 mph) |
| AC Charging (Standard) | 11 kW (approx. 7 hours 0-100%) |
| AC Charging (Optional) | 22 kW (approx. 3 hours 45 mins 0-100%) |
| DC Fast Charging (Max) | 160 kW (approx. 30 mins 20-80%) |
| Length | 4.79 m |
| Width | 1.89 m |
| Height | 1.69 m |
| Boot Capacity (5-seat mode) | 748 litres |
| Boot Capacity (2-seat mode) | 1,815 litres |
| Towing Capacity | 1,200 kg |

Mastering the Urban Landscape: The Daily Commute
Family SUVs: Driving long distances or fast doesn’t show everything that makes a good family SUV. The standard car test is the daily commute, and it is there that most cars will make or break themselves. It is amidst this grinding rhythm of city traffic, stop-start pacing, and bad roads that the comfort of a car and its ease of use would be tested the most. The Peugeot e-5008 73 kWh Dual Motor is nothing short of brilliant in this context, turning the frequently tiresome daily routine into a notably tranquil and effortless ride. Its ingenious engineering is focused right on alleviating driver fatigue and improving cabin comfort, so it’s a perfect refuge in the urban jungle.The e-5008 really comes into its own in traffic, too. The twin virtues of its silent electric powertrain and quick, effortless acceleration make crawling through stop-and-go traffic surprisingly fun. There’s no heat from the engine or anything to make you sweat, there’s no vibrations, and it’s enough to create a calm space that helps you relax and forget about the stress from your daily commute. A big part of that usability is the well-tuned regenerative braking system. Peugeot offers several regeneration stages that can be switched via paddles (left one adds regeneration / right one reduces) behind the steering wheel, which bestows control to the driver to customise the experience. At its most aggressive, it offers “one-pedal” driving, where releasing the accelerator is enough to bring the vehicle to a stop. It’s incredibly intuitive, even for EV novices, and makes stop-and-go traffic not-so-tiring on the feet.On a more prosaic level, the e-5008 also delivers on the often overlooked quality of ride comfort when negotiating rough urban streets. Its suspension is soft, perfectly smoothing out the jolts and shakes from uneven surfaces, potholes, and manhole lids. It skims over bumps that would upset other SUVs, always holding its poise and its passengers remain comfortably seated. And when you combine that plush ride with the super-silenced interior of the vehicle, you’ve got yourself one tranquil environment that feels a cut above. That emphasis on comfort elevates the e-5008 from being just a versatile family mover to a genuinely premium proposition for day-to-day motoring.

How the e-5008 Stacks Up: A Competitive Showdown
The Peugeot e-5008 is a new entrant in the electric family SUV market that’s getting rather crowded. That its case is strong by itself is to be expected, but potential buyers will of course want to know how it stacks up against the competition. In this electric SUV comparison, we pit the Peugeot e-5008 73 kWh Dual Motor against notable rivals such as the Tesla Model Y, Kia EV9, and Volkswagen ID. Buzz in order to find out where it shines and what its unique selling points are. We will judge them on parameters which matter the most to a family – performance, range, practicality & technology.There’s all of that, plus a variety of different interpretations of what an electric family car should be. The standard for performance and charging infrastructure is the Tesla Model Y; the Kia EV9 features bold styling and a roomy interior, and the VW ID. Buzz embraces the retro charm and the van-like practicality. The Peugeot e-5008 is looking for the ideal sweet spot between high design, hi-tech equipment and flexible seven-seat practicality. To test: e-5008 makes a fine first impression. This comparison may provide you with insight into which model would be best suited for your needs.
| Feature | Peugeot e-5008 (Dual Motor) | Tesla Model Y (Long Range) | Kia EV9 (AWD) | Volkswagen ID. Buzz (LWB)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Powertrain | Dual Motor AWD | Dual Motor AWD | Dual Motor AWD | Rear-Wheel Drive |
| Power | 240 kW / 320 bhp | ~378 kW / 507 bhp | 283 kW / 379 bhp | 210 kW / 282 bhp |
| 0-100 km/h | 6.9 seconds | 5.0 seconds | 5.3 seconds | 7.9 seconds |
| Range (WLTP) | ~500 km / 310 miles | ~533 km / 331 miles | ~512 km / 318 miles | ~474 km / 295 miles |
| Seating | 7 seats (standard) | 7 seats (optional) | 7 seats (standard) | 7 seats (standard) |
| Boot Space | 748 L (5-seat mode) | 971 L (5-seat mode) | 828 L (5-seat mode) | 1,340 L (5-seat mode) |
| Interior Tech | 21″ Panoramic i-Cockpit® | 15″ Central Touchscreen | Dual 12.3″ Screens | 12.9″ Touchscreen |
| Key Advantage | Premium interior design & tech | Performance & charging network | Interior space & V2L capability | Retro style & van-like practicality |
What jumps out from the comparison is plenty. The Tesla Model Y still reigns supreme for straight-line acceleration and has the advantage of the extensive, reliable Supercharger network. However, its optional third row is a lot more cramped than the e-5008’s standard seven-seat configuration, and its minimalist cabin design may not suit everyone.Arguably, the e-5008’s closest competitor is the Kia EV9, which boasts comparable range, standard seven seats, and ample power. The EV9 is bigger inside and offers the handy Vehicle-to-Load (V2L) technology. Peugeot’s answer is a more refined and focused driver cockpit with the breathtaking Panoramic i-Cockpit®. You may simply prefer the EV9’s striking, futuristic appearance or the e-5008’s classic and polished French styling.The Volkswagen ID. Buzz is highly practical and fun to drive, but can’t match the others in performance or range. It has van-like packaging that provides a best-in-class amount of cargo space, but the driving is less carlike. The Peugeot e-5008 positions itself as the more dynamic and premium choice without sacrificing the very purposeful seven-seater practicality and without coming across as a boxy workhorse. In the end, the Peugeot e-5008 soars high by delivering a fine mix of stylish design, a truly premium-feeling interior, and cutting-edge technology that its rivals find hard to match in a single complete solution.
